To explore Dubrovnik’s famous city walls, you’ve got three main entrances to choose from. Whilst Pile and Ploče usually get the most attention, Buže Gate is just as impressive as the rest, and the youngest of the three! In the early 20th century, the Austro-Hungarian army broke through the wall and created what we now know as Buže Gate. You heard that right… Dubrovnik was part of the Austro-Hungarian Empire from 1815 until its fall in 1918. Today, the gate leads straight into the maze of Old Town, lined with many spots to try out the local cuisine! Sounds tempting, but get ready to climb a seemingly endless number of stairs…
